~~> Android 2.0.1 Eclair ( API 6 )

- Version : 2.0.1
- Release Date : December 3, 2009
- Features : Minor API changes, bugfixes and framework behavior changes.
   

~~> Android 2.1 Eclair ( API 7 )

- Version : 2.1
- Release Date : January 12, 2010
- Features : Minor amendments to the API and bugfixes


~~> Android 2.2 Froyo ( API 8 )

             On May 20, 2010, the SDK for Android 2.2 (Froyo, short for frozen yogurt) was released, based on Linux kernel 2.6.32.

- Version : 2.2
- Release Date : May 20, 2010
- Features : 

          - Speed, memory, and performance optimizations.

          - Improved application launcher with shortcuts to Phone and Browser applications and USB tethering and Wi-Fi hotspot functionality.

          - Updated Market application with batch and automatic update features and Option to disable data access over mobile network.

          -  Support for Bluetooth-enabled car and desk docks and also support for numeric and alphanumeric passwords.

          - Additional application speed improvements, implemented through JIT compilation.

~~> Android 2.3 Gingerbread ( API 9 )

             On December 6, 2010, the Android 2.3 (Gingerbread) was released, based on Linux kernel 2.6.35.

- Version : 2.3
- Release Date : December 6, 2010
- Features :

      - Support for extra-large screen sizes and resolutions (WXGA and higher) and native support for SIP VoIP internet telephony.

      - Faster, more intuitive text input in virtual keyboard, with improved accuracy, better suggested text and voice input mode.

      - New audio effects such as reverb, equalization, headphone virtualization, and bass boost and Enhanced support for native code development.

      - Audio, graphical, and input enhancements for game developers and concurrent garbage collection for increased performance.

      - Support for WebM/VP8 video playback, and AAC audio encoding.
